Chapter 144 Invitation
After meeting Arnold, Cora walked alone on the street. There were very few pedestrians. Everyone had probably gone home to reunite with their families. Perhaps due to the lack of people on the street or some other reason, Cora felt extremely lonely. At that moment, the phone in her coat pocket vibrated again. She hesitated for a moment before taking out her phone to check. There were several missed calls from Byron. Remembering his indifferent expression, Cora didn’t want to see him right away. Thus, she skipped his missed calls and checked the message from Tyler instead. [Cora, are you coming over?] Only then did Cora recall that she had promised Tyler to go to the Cooper Villa for a Christmas Eve dinner.
However, ever since Tyler found out about her affair with Byron during a drunken incident, he has been avoiding her. She thought he must have looked down on her behavior and ended their friendship unilaterally. Yet she figured that was for the best. She thought lowly of herself as well, so she understood his cold treatment of her. It was unexpected that Tyler would send her a message on Christmas Eve. Before she replied to his text, he called her. “Cora, where are you? I’ll give you a ride. It’s difficult to find a taxi on Christmas Eve.” Tyler sounded as enthusiastic as ever while talking to her over the phone. At that moment, Cora felt she was on the verge of tears.
